In this period died, in the eighty-sixth year of her age, Livia Drusilla, mother of the emperor, and the relict of Augustus, whom she survived fifteen years.
She was the daughter of I Drusus Calidianus and married Tiberius Claudius Nero, by whom she had two sons,...
